Wander Franco Injury Update:
Star shortstop Wander Franco experienced a hamstring strain during the game on April 19th. The severity is currently classified as day-to-day, though he is expected to miss at least the next three games. This absence significantly impacts the Rays' offensive capabilities, as Franco is a key run producer and a crucial part of their lineup. His return date is uncertain, pending further evaluation. The Rays are closely monitoring his progress and will provide updates as they become available.
Shane Baz Injury Update:
Starting pitcher Shane Baz, still recovering from Tommy John surgery, experienced a minor setback in his rehab program. While not a new injury, the delay pushes back his anticipated return to the mound. The Rays are proceeding cautiously with his rehabilitation, prioritizing long-term health over rushing his comeback. Further details regarding his timeline are expected in the coming week.

Aaron Judge Injury Update:
The Yankees faced a significant scare when star outfielder Aaron Judge left a game early on April 18th due to a hip injury. While initial reports suggested a minor strain, further examinations are needed to determine the severity and his time of absence. The team has yet to specify a return date, classifying it as “day-to-day,” leaving fans and team management in suspense. The injury's impact on the Yankees' lineup and their ability to contend is considerable.
Giancarlo Stanton Injury Update:
Giancarlo Stanton, another key hitter for the Yankees, felt tightness in his hamstring during a game on April 17th and was removed from the game as a precaution. While tests have revealed no significant tear, he's listed as day-to-day. His absence reduces the Yankees' power in the lineup.
